On 05/10/2020 15:06, Robert Wooden wrote:
> After sending the email I realized that I did not mention that while
> rebuilding the OS, I kept the "old" /srv/samba files. Which in turn
> kept the old permission settings. I think (could be wrong) that
> keeping the old SID are now different from the new SID's created while
> rebuilding to v4.12.6.
>
> To answer your DC question:
> root at dc1:~# wbinfo -s S-1-5-21-589789-1426474111-2143966843-500
> failed to call wbcLookupSid: WBC_ERR_DOMAIN_NOT_FOUND
> Could not lookup sid S-1-5-21-589789-1426474111-2143966843-500
> root at dc1:~# wbinfo -s S-1-5-21-589789-1426474111-2143966843-512
> failed to call wbcLookupSid: WBC_ERR_DOMAIN_NOT_FOUND
> Could not lookup sid S-1-5-21-589789-1426474111-2143966843-512
> root at dc1:~# wbinfo -s S-1-5-21-589789-1426474111-2143966843-513
> failed to call wbcLookupSid: WBC_ERR_DOMAIN_NOT_FOUND
> Could not lookup sid S-1-5-21-589789-1426474111-2143966843-513
>
You possibly have major problems
How did you rebuild the OS ?
Did you provision a new domain ?
If so, you will now have a new domain SID and anything from the old
domain that contains a SID will have a different SID
